Ram Jet 350 vs. 350 H.O. Deluxe

Hi,I'm in the process of restoring a 70 C10. I plan to use the truck as a daily driver and do a little towing to the track. The truck has an inline 6,3 speed on the column,and 3.73s. I want to put a 700R4,keep the 3.73s,and put a 350 in it,preferably a crate motor for convenience,but I can't decide on whether to get the 350 H.O. Deluxe or the Ram Jet 350. The H.O. Deluxe is about $1000 cheaper than the Ram Jet but I know the Ram Jet will most likely get better fuel economy and have better street manners than the H.O. Deluxe. Is the step up to the Ram Jet worth it? What kind of gas mileage would each get? Thanks in advance for the help!
